Global Landmark Dominations

Global Landmark Dominations place your brand on the world’s most famous advertising stages, creating unparalleled visibility and global impact. From the bright lights of Piccadilly Circus and Times Square to the bustling energy of Shibuya Crossing and the prestige of Chateau Marmont, these high-profile locations ensure your campaign reaches millions in the most influential and culturally significant destinations.

Why Choose an Global Landmark Domination?

    • Unmatched Global Exposure – Your brand will be seen by millions of locals, tourists, and online audiences in some of the world’s busiest locations.
    • Premium, High-Impact Advertising – Dominating a landmark site elevates your brand stature, associating it with the biggest global names.
    • Social & Viral Potential – These locations are heavily photographed and shared on social media, giving your campaign organic reach far beyond the physical site.
    • Dynamic Digital & Static Options – Choose from large-format LED screens, projection mapping, 3D digital billboards, or traditional wraps to create immersive brand experiences.
    • Cultural & Brand Alignment – Position your brand in the world’s most iconic cultural and commercial hubs, reinforcing prestige, relevance, and authority.

Make Your Brand a Global Landmark

An iconic OOH takeover is more than just an ad—it’s a statement. Whether launching a new product, celebrating a milestone, or making a bold brand statement, these legendary sites offer unrivalled visibility and prestige.

 

Ready to dominate the world’s most famous advertising locations? Contact us today to plan your iconic landmark OOH takeover campaign!